Title:COM Object Instantiation Memory Corruption Vulnerability
Description:Microsoft Internet Explorer 5.01 and 6 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by instantiating certain COM objects from Urlmon.dll, which triggers memory corruption during a call to the IObjectSafety function.
Family:windowsClass:vulnerability
Status:ACCEPTEDReference(s):CVE-2007-0218
Platform(s):Microsoft Windows 2000
Microsoft Windows Server 2003
Microsoft Windows XP
Product(s):Microsoft Internet Explorer
Definition Synopsis
  • IE 5.01,SP4 on Win2k,SP4
  • Microsoft Windows 2000 SP4 or later is installed
  • AND Microsoft Internet Explorer 5.01 SP4 is installed
  • AND the version of Mshtml.dll is less than 5.0.3853.3000
  • OR IE 6 on Win 2k, SP4
  • Microsoft Windows 2000 SP4 or later is installed
  • AND Internet Explorer 6 Service Pack 1 is installed
  • AND the version of Mshtml.dll is less than 6.0.2800.1595
  • OR IE 6 on Win XP SP2
  • Microsoft Windows XP SP2 or later is installed
  • AND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 is installed
  • AND the version of Mshtml.dll is less than 6.0.2900.3132
  • OR IE 6 on Win 2k3 SP1
  • Microsoft Windows Server 2003 SP1 (x86) is installed
  • AND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 is installed
  • AND the version of Mshtml.dll is less than 6.0.3790.2920
  • OR IE 6 on Win 2k3 SP2
  • Microsoft Windows Server 2003 SP2 (x86) is installed
  • AND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 is installed
  • AND the version of Mshtml.dll is less than 6.0.3790.4064
  • OR IE 6 on Win XP SP2 (64-bit)
  •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 is installed
  • AND the version of Mshtml.dll is less than 6.0.3790.4064
  • AND Microsoft Windows XP x64 Edition SP2 is installed
  • OR IE 6 on Win XP SP1 (64-bit)
  • Microsoft Windows XP SP1 (64-bit) is installed
  • AND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 is installed
  • AND the version of Mshtml.dll is less than 6.0.3790.2920
